Biological Metrics Described: Types and Uses

Biological markers, also referred to as biometrics, are biological organisms or substances that provide a measurable indication of environmental status. They are valuable resources for assessing the health of ecosystems. There are several kinds of biosignals, each presenting unique insights. These generally belong into a few primary groups:

  • Sentinel Species: Creatures that are particularly vulnerable to natural changes, showing early signs of stress. Examples include certain lichen or amphibians.
  • Community Indicators: Studying the presence and variety of an entire living community to determine overall ecosystem condition.
  • Biochemical Indicators: Measuring particular chemicals, like toxins, in biological tissues or the habitat to reveal exposure to pollutants substances.
These applications are broad, encompassing environmental condition assessment, pollution discovery, and observing the influence of climate change. Proper understanding of biosignal data is crucial for sound environmental regulation and protection efforts.

Why Bio Tests Represent Vital for Sterilizing

Guaranteeing thorough sterilization within healthcare equipment & supplies is paramount for patient safety plus preventing infection. Biological indicators often referred to as bioindicators – give a considerably more reliable assessment than chemical and physical indicators. They actually demonstrate the ability of eliminate viable microorganisms, such as bacterial spores, which is far more resistant to sterilization processes than many other forms of life. Therefore, employing biological indicators is a crucial step in validating and the effectiveness of sterilization procedures.
